Although not an original idea, Donkey Kong became famous for popularizing platformers in 1981 following a similar game titled Space Panic (1980). Keep in mind, this refers to standing arcade cabinets. Later Donkey Kong Jr. (1982) and Mario Bros. (1983) helped Nintendo transition from arcade cabinets to consoles! They released the Nintendo Entertainment System (NES) also in 1983. Later second-generation consoles like the Sega Genesis, Super NES, and a few years later Playstation improved on platform games with titles like Super Mario World (1990), Sonic the Hedgehog (1991), and Crash Bandicoot (1996).
